Heat Advisory issued September 2 at 2:54AM EDT until September 3 at 8:00PM EDT by NWS Pittsburgh PA
* WHAT...Heat index values up to 102 expected. * WHERE...Portions of east central Ohio, southwest and western Pennsylvania, and northern and the northern panhandle of West Virginia. * WHEN...From 8 AM this morning to 8 PM EDT Thursday. *…

A heat advisory issued at 2:54 a.m. EDT on September 2 warns that heat index values could reach 102. It applies to parts of east‑central Ohio, southwest and western Pennsylvania, and northern West Virginia, including the northern panhandle. The advisory is in effect from 8 a.m. this morning until 8 p.m. EDT on Thursday, and officials note that the combination of hot temperatures and high humidity may lead to heat‑related illnesses.
